Three women are depicted walking on a paved road in Barakin Akawo, Nigeria, under bright, possibly sunny, conditions. The woman on the left wears a black full-length garment and a black hijab, with light-colored sandals. The central woman wears an olive-green full-length garment and matching hijab, with dark sandals. The woman on the right wears a burgundy full-length garment, a matching hijab, a black face mask, and dark shoes. In the immediate foreground, to the right, is a damaged concrete culvert or drain with visible water or debris beneath it. A single light-colored brick rests on the pavement near the leftmost woman's feet. The road surface appears to be asphalt or concrete. To the right, running parallel to the road, is a row of single-story buildings or stalls with corrugated metal roofs and barred windows. Utility poles and lines are visible further down the road. In the background, to the left, a light-colored sedan and other vehicles are visible on the road, indicating traffic. The sky above is very bright, suggesting an outdoor daytime setting.
